Five Positive Jams – Number Three: Stay Positive, by the Hold Steady

10/7/2015

0 Comments

 
Picture
The Hold Steady has always possessed a knack for combining gritty imagery with relentless determination.  Known for their self-referential songwriting, themes from the band’s entire canon emerge in this one single tune. In fact, a seasoned Hold Steady listener (there's a devoted fan base dubbed the Unified Scene) will recognize many of lead singer Craig Finn’s callbacks to earlier songs: Massive Nights, Positive Jam, and How a Resurrection Really Feels.

But at its core, this song is a love letter to fans, with Finn sincerely concluding, “We couldn't have done this if it wasn't for you.”
​Although each self-reference may not entirely resonate with new listeners, it is the inspiring chorus that preaches a universal message. And with a song title after my own heart, Craig Finn truly delivers the song's mantra by chanting, “We gotta stay positive.”
